What are two types of uncertainty migrants may experience when they begin interacting in the "host" culture, according to the anxiety and uncertainty management model?

    Explanation:Predictive uncertainty occurs when one is unable to predict what someone is going to do or say, while explanatory uncertainty occurs during moments of cultural adaptation while someone is trying to make sense of someone else's behaviour
